Chili-Lime Chicken Bowls

Chili-Lime Chicken Bowls: Quick, Zesty Delight in 35 Minutes

Chili-Lime Chicken Bowls are a quick, protein-rich meal bursting with flavor and freshness, perfect for busy weeknights.
Prep Time 35 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Marination Time 30 minutes
Total Time 1 hour 15 minutes
Servings: 4 bowls
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: Mexican
Calories: 480

Ingredients
  

For the Chicken Marinade
  • 2 pieces Chicken Breasts boneless and skinless
  • 2 tablespoons Olive Oil or avocado oil
  • 1 tablespoon Lime Juice freshly squeezed
  • 1 tablespoon Lime Zest
  • 1 teaspoon Chili Powder or smoked paprika
  • 1 teaspoon Cumin omit if unavailable
  • 1 teaspoon Garlic Powder or fresh minced garlic
  • 1 teaspoon Salt to taste
  • 1/2 teaspoon Black Pepper freshly ground
For the Bowl Assembly
  • 2 cups Cooked Quinoa or Rice quinoa is gluten-free
  • 1 cup Cherry Tomatoes halved
  • 1 cup Corn canned, fresh, or frozen
  • 1 medium Avocado sliced
  • 1/4 cup Fresh Cilantro chopped
  • 2 pieces Lime Wedges for serving

Equipment

  • Grill or skillet
  • Mixing bowl
  • Measuring spoons
  • Cutting Board
  • Chef's knife

Method
 

Preparation Steps
  1. Marinate the Chicken: Mix olive oil, lime juice, lime zest, chili powder, cumin, garlic powder, salt, and pepper in a bowl. Add chicken breasts and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es.
  2. Preheat the Grill: Heat your grill or skillet over medium-high heat.
  3. Cook the Chicken: Grill chicken breasts for 6-7 minutes on each side until golden brown and intern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C). Let it rest.
  4. Prepare the Bowls: Add cooked quinoa or rice to the bottom of serving bowls.
  5. Add Fresh Veggies: Slice the chicken and layer it atop the quinoa or rice. Add cherry tomatoes and corn.
  6. Garnish with Avocado and Herbs: Top with sliced avocado and cilantro. Serve with lime wedges.
  7. Repeat and Serve: Assemble bowls as needed and serve immediately.

Notes

For best flavor, marinate longer and use fresh ingredients. Store assembled bowls in airtight containers for up to 3 days.
